Directions:
Directions:
Light oven; get bowl, spoons, and ingredients. Grease pan, crack nuts. Remove 18 blocks and seven toy autos from kitchen table. Measure two cups of flour, remove Johnny's hands from flour; wash flour off him. Put flour, baking powder, and salt in sifter. Get dustpan and brush up pieces of bowl that Johnny knocked on floor. Get another bowl. Answer the doorbell. Return to kitchen. Remove Johnny's hands from bowl. Wash Johnny. Get out egg. Answer phone. Return. Take out greased pan. Remove 1/4 inch salt from pan. Look for Johnny. Return to kitchen and find Johnny; remove his hands from bowl; wash shortening, etc., off him. Take up greased pan and find 1/4 inch layer of nutshells in it. Head for Johnny, who flees, knocking bowl off table. Wash kitchen floor. Wash table. Wash walls. Wash dishes. Call a baker. Lie down.
